Planning around existing structures to control costs

A primary design challenge in this Barbican residential building was the structural load-bearing concrete walls. These dense walls easily transmit low-frequency subwoofer bass vibrations to adjacent apartments, causing noise issues.

We built a fully decoupled secondary timber frame isolated with rubber dampening clips (resilient channels) to form a "room-within-a-room." This prevents sound vibrations from traveling directly into the concrete structure.

Silent Mechanical Ventilation inside Soundproof Seals

The Problem: Soundproof theater doors and thick wall seals block outside noises, but trap heat and stale air, causing high CO2 build-up during long movies. Standard home ventilation systems are too noisy, producing background hums that disrupt quiet movie scenes.

The Solution: We integrated a low-velocity mechanical ventilation system with built-in baffle silencer boxes inside the ceiling bulkheads. This keeps air fresh and moving quietly (running below NC-20), maintaining a silent environment.

The Client's Challenges

Remodeling this Barbican residential home cinema required addressing several complex technical and acoustic challenges:

  • Structural bass sound leakage: Subwoofer low-frequencies traveling through solid concrete building walls.
  • Stuffy air in soundproof rooms: Standard ventilation fans creating loud background noise in a sealed room.
  • Blocked rear sightlines: Seating layouts on flat floors blocking screen views from the back row.
  • Ceiling vibration buzzing: Projector brackets and lighting fixtures vibrating during high-bass sequences.
  • Messy system cabling: Routing power cords and HDMI cables discreetly behind custom fabric panels.

Atmospheric & Lighting Solutions

Lighting Challenge

Recessed Ceiling and Accent Lighting Loops

To transition the theater room from bright cleaning light to an immersive movie night ambiance, we split the lighting circuits. Recessed task spotlights illuminate walkway paths, while custom fiber-optic starry sky ceilings and dimmable LEDs behind fabric wall panels create a relaxed cinema mood.

Cinema Renovation FAQs

How do you prevent heavy subwoofer bass from leaking into neighboring rooms?

We build an isolated secondary timber wall frame separated from the main masonry using rubber acoustic clips and resilient channels. This decouples structural sound paths, preventing vibration travel.
